  第四节:短文理解

  IV. 短文理解(Passages)(共10小题,计10分)

  请听下面两篇短文,然后根据你所听到的短文内容,选择能回答所提问题的最佳选项。每篇短文读两遍。

  (A)

  21. Why has the author been successful in his studies?

  A. He is cleverer than others.

  B. He studies harder than others.

  C. His parents help him.

  D. He spends as much time studying as his classmates.

  22. What do we know about the author from his childhood?

  A. He had a good memory.

  B. He was a naughty boy.

  C. He showed interest in playing football.

  D. He didn't follow his parents' advice.

  23. Which subject was he not good at when he was a senior high student?

  A. English. B. History.

  C. Maths. D. Geography.

  24. How did he get on with his classmates?

  A. Very well, they would help him work out difficult problems.

  B. Very well, they helped him take notes in class.

  C. Not very well, so he had to ask his parents for help.

  D. Not very well, so his mind was often somewhere else when he was in class.

  25. Which of the following statements is true?

  A. The author relied 100% on his own abilities when he was at senior high school.

  B. The author never knew what his weaknesses and strengths were.

  C. The author never spent his spare time in reading.

  D. The author would like to introduce his study experience to others.

  通过各问题题干和所给备选项可大致了解这篇短文是作者在介绍自己的学习经历。在听之前可进行初步推断。第21小题题干中用现在完成时,表示一贯如此,所以备选项B最合理。第23小题问的是细节题,第24小题也是这样, 将所问的内容及所给的备选项大致记下。这样听的时候有的放矢, 便于问题的作答。

  【录音原文】Part IV. Passages

  Listen to the following two passages and choose the best answer to each question. Each passage will be read twice.

  Passage A

  (Man) I am now a college student. I think I have been successful in my studies, but I am not the kind of student who is cleverer than others. I know perfectly well that I need to spend more time than others on my studies. Only by working hard can I make great achievements in my studies.

  As a child I'd learn things by heart,poems, for example, but then my parents would give me a hand. When I was at senior high school, I didn't rely 100% on my own abilities. I knew then what my weaknesses and strengths were, so I didn't study on my own. I was good at history,geography and English, for example, but not good at maths. Whenever I met with a difficult problem that I couldn't work out, I would turn to my teachers or classmates for help. I wouldn't be any good without the help of my teachers and classmates.

  I was always wide awake when the teachers were explaining things. I would take notes. All I needed to do later was to look through the notes I had made, to make sure I would remember things,otherwise I'd soon forget them.

  I would spend much of my spare time reading all sorts of extra reading materials, which were no doubt very useful.

  I often try to help the senior high students by telling them to study as I did,but of course what works for me may not work for others.

  Key: 21. B 22. A 23. C 24. A 25. D

  (B)

  26. What is the Blue Restaurant like?

  A. It is not a new place.

  B. It is not a high building.

  C. It is not so clean.

  D. It is nameless.

  27. Why do people like this restaurant?

  A. It is the largest building in the city. B. The name of the restaurant sounds good.

  C. It serves delicious food and the service is excellent.

  D. It has candle-light in the hall.

  28. Why might people like to give this restaurant another try?

  A. The food there is cheap.

  B. All the customers can enjoy the beautiful scenery from the restaurant.

  C. The restaurant has a handsome boss.

  D. There have been some improvements to the restaurant.

  29. Where does this restaurant lie?

  A. Beside the River Thames.

  B. Beyond the city centre of London.

  C. Under a bridge. D. In a ship.

  30. Who can enjoy the excellent views of the River Thames and Tower Bridge?

  A. Only the people sitting at the indoor tables.

  B. Only the people sitting by the windows.

  C. People sitting anywhere in the restaurant.

  D. People walking around in the restaurant.

  从各问题题干和所给备选项中可了解到本篇短文是介绍一家餐馆特色的。第30小题暗示在这里可以看到the River Thames and Tower Bridge,所以第29小题中的A项与第30小题中的B项较为合理。人们常去一家餐馆的最一般的理由是food 与service的质量,所以第27小题中C项更为合理。联系整体,第26小题应排除C项与D项。听两遍录音, 确定答案。

  【录音原文】Passage B

  Tonight we're taking a look at one of the city's leading restaurants-the Blue Restaurant. Our idea was to find places not only where the food is good and the service all you'd expect it to be, but also where you get a good view at the same time.

  Well, this restaurant is not a new place, but if you've been there before, you might like to give it another try because there have been a number of improvements here in the last few months. We'd advise you to sit by the windows and enjoy the excellent views of the River Thames, whatever the weather. If it gets too hot, the glass slides back and you're in the open air, but if it gets cold or starts to rain, the windows will close by themselves. Another advantage is that, from there, you can get an excellent view of Tower Bridge, which is not really visible from the indoor tables.

  Key: 26. A 27. C 28 . D 29. A 30. B
